Following his successful foray into genre filmmaking with OUT OF SIGHT, Soderburgh returns with a nod to seminal sixties and seventies avenger thrillers like GET CARTER and POINT BLANK. Stamp plays ans English born ex-con who travels to L.A. to investigate the mysterious death of his daughter. The trail leads to a sleazy record producer (Fonda) and mounting levels of violence. A stylish tour de force, THE LIMEY boasts a taut, intricate script, an evocative period soundtrack and excellent use of California locations. But the biggest treat is the performance by sixties icons Stamp and Fonda.
